Output d0431b783001ba1161575df24d99c99e5a33b7a55a6d716918f55b8bdc1b94e4:8

value
151875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94bce4a3a54e2e38e0b28c486545f84060a0cf7e OP_EQUAL
address
3FFUDTZsPwfft1jq5x9RcB1ESeudxHD8LA
transaction
d0431b783001ba1161575df24d99c99e5a33b7a55a6d716918f55b8bdc1b94e4
confirmations
201748
spent
true